Each targetlist has a property called "targets" which contains the array of targets. This property is not available on the abstract TargetList class. It is only available on the specific types, e.g. GeoTargetList.targets:
http://code.google.com/apis/adwords/v2009/docs/reference/CampaignTargetService.GeoTargetList.html In VB.NET you should loop on the page.entries, check their type and cast into that type, e.g. CType(entries(x), GeoTargetList).targets Cheers -- =~=~=~=~=~=~=~=~=~=~=~=~=~=~=~=~=~=~=~=~=~=~=~=~ Have you migrated to v200909 yet?
